This volume of the excellent Avatar series contains the final four episodes of the shows first season. Of the four episodes on this DVD the first is pretty much a stand alone episode that sees Aang and friends investigate reports of activity in the supposedly abandoned Northern Air Temple. What he finds there depresses and angers him but he is soon forced to put these thoughts aside in order to defend the temple from a fire nation attack. This is an okay episode and although it is really only a filler episode before the season finale, there are some suggestions of the future towards the end.

This is it boys and girls this is where Bleach starts to go from good to great. In this, the begining of the second season battling hollows is left behind for more climatic fights between the soul reapers and the Ryoka. This volume includes episodes twenty-one to thirty-two. The series pick up with Ichigo, Uryu, Orihime, Chad and the cat Yoruichi infiltrate the soul society in there mission to rescue Rukia. The highlight if this volume is without a doubt the showdown between ichigo and Renji Abarai with the volume ending explaining the background to both Renji and Rukia and how they became soul reapers. I highly recomend this dvd, as it is this series that sets the shape of things to come for the shows later series.

`Ghost in the Shell' and `Akira' are often hailed as something of a turning point for Japanese Animated film - it's grown up, articulate, deep.

When you watch this DVD, if it's the first time you've seen the film then much of what you see feels familiar. And that's not surprising considering this has embedded itself deep into film culture - take the opening credits for example and you'll see the direct influence on American thought-provoker - the Matrix.

This film presents concepts which take some thinking about to fully understand, definitely a film to be watched twice. This feels more like a live action film than anime, and that's not all down to the beautifully detailed artwork, it's due to the realistic feel of the story.
